A feeding system for medical waste turnover case
Technical Field
The utility model belongs to the mechanical structure field, concretely relates to a feeding system for medical waste has enough to meet need case.
Background
The medical waste contains a large amount of bacteria, infectious viruses and other harmful substances, and has direct and indirect infectivity, toxicity and harmfulness, in order to reduce the possibility of manual contact in the operation process as much as possible, the feeding of the medical waste high-temperature steam centralized processing system needs to adopt mechanization and automation as much as possible, in the prior art, the feeding of the medical waste turnover box mostly depends on a guide rail and a cylinder to drive turnover, the number of parts used by the structure is large, the prices of the parts are high, the later maintenance and replacement are troublesome, the guide rail has to be a long straight line structure, and the occupied space is large.

Detailed Description
The following are specific embodiments of the present invention and the accompanying drawings are used to further describe the technical solution of the present invention, but the present invention is not limited to these embodiments.
As shown in fig. 1 to 3, the feeding system for the medical waste transfer container includes: a frame 1 provided with a loading gear 2 and a unloading gear 3; the driving piece is arranged in the frame 1 and is connected with the feeding gear 2; the conveying chain 4 is arranged in the frame 1, and the conveying chain 4 is meshed with the feeding gear 2 and the discharging gear 3; the conveying boxes 5 are arranged at intervals and are rotationally connected with the conveying chain 4; the stop rod 6 is arranged in the frame 1, is positioned below the discharging gear 3 and movably abuts against one of the conveying boxes 5; when the conveying box 5 abuts against the stop rod 6, the conveying chain 4 moves to drive the conveying box 5 to turn over.
The driving piece can drive material loading gear 2 and rotate, carry chain 4 and material loading gear 2 and 3 meshing connections of gear of unloading, just can drive transport chain 4 and remove when material loading gear 2 rotates, and then drive transport case 5 and remove, when transport case 5 removes to leaning on when leaning on backstop pole 6, transport chain 4 continues to remove, can drive transport case 5 and transport chain 4 junction at this moment and continue to move forward, and then make transport case 5 overturn, can pour out the article in transport case 5 promptly, transport case 5 is provided with a plurality of, through setting up the interval between per two transport cases 5, article can be put into in other transport cases 5 in the time of material pouring to transport case 5 in time, improve material loading efficiency.
The conveying chains can be enclosed into different shapes, such as squares or circles, and compared with a guide rail type conveying chain, the conveying chain can reduce more occupied area and occupied space.
The driving member includes: a mounting platform 7 provided in the frame 1; the driving motor 8 is arranged on the mounting platform 7, and a driving gear 9 is arranged on the driving motor 8; a rotating shaft 10 rotatably connected to the mounting platform 7, the rotating shaft 10 being provided with a rotating gear 11; a drive chain 12 which is in meshed connection with both the drive gear 9 and the rotary gear 11; and the transmission chain 13 is meshed and connected with the rotating gear 11 and the feeding gear 2.
The driving motor 8 can drive the driving gear 9 to rotate, and the driving chain 12 is meshed with the driving gear 9 and the rotating gear 11, so that the driving gear 9 rotates to drive the rotating shaft to rotate, and the rotating shaft drives the conveying chain 4 to move through the transmission rack, and the advantage of this is that the moving speed of the conveying chain 4 can be adjusted by adjusting the size of the rotating gear 11.
The frame 1 is provided with the tensioning gear 14, the tensioning gear 14 abuts against the conveying chain 4, and different tensioning degrees of the conveying chain 4 can be adjusted by arranging the tensioning gears 14 with different diameters.
The conveying chain 4 is fixedly provided with a rotating shaft 15, the rotating shaft 15 is rotatably inserted into the conveying box 5, and the conveying box 5 can rotate around the rotating shaft 15 when being overturned.
The conveying box 5 is provided with an accommodating cavity 16 with an upward opening, the accommodating cavity 16 is upward in opening, and when the conveying box 5 normally moves, articles are guaranteed to be stably placed in the accommodating cavity 16.
